Program Calendar
The fifteen month Advanced Diploma program consists of four parts:
- a 3 week residency in Vancouver
- followed by an 12 month distance learning component
- a second two week residency in Vancouver
- and concludes with a Final Project.
PART I: Three Week Summer Residency in Vancouver
| Summer Intensive: |
Learning includes direct art therapy experiential learning, labs and course work. For some classes, preparation reading will be required in advance. Assignments will be submitted according to instructors’ requirements. |
| |
|
| Courses include: |
- Art Therapy Training Group I
- Art Therapy Techniques Lab I
- Art Therapy Techniques Advanced
- Assessment: Art Therapy Assessment Techniques - Interventions: Group and Family Art Therapy
- Introduction to Practicum
- Introduction to Supervision |

PART II: 12 month Distance Learning
| Online Courses include: |
| - Interventions: |
(i) Child Art Therapy
(ii) Adolescent Art Therapy |
- Art Therapy History and Theory |
| |
|
| Practicum requirements: |
700 hours of art therapy practical experience arranged in a local school, agency, hospital or community setting in the students’ home town. (350 hours direct client contact, the balance are work related activities). The practicum site must be approved by Vancouver Art Therapy Institute. Students are covered by liability insurance. |
| |
|
| Supervision requirements: |
25 hours of individual Supervision via internet and teleconferencing |

PART III: 2 Week Second Summer Residency in Vancouver
Second summer intensive conducted in a similar manner as the first.
Online Courses
include: |
- Art Therapy Training Group II
- Art Therapy Techniques Lab II
- Assessment: Art Therapy Assessment
(Field research)
- Group Supervision |
|
|
PART IV: Final Project
A Creative Venture |
